Surviving the Frost

 
I hadn't been out to check on the Garden (boxes) in a few weeks. We did not plant a fall garden this year, but I still had some things planted from the summer. We had a frost a couple of nights before and I did not have high hopes of anything surviving. To my surprise, the Kale was still going strong. So was the Swiss Chard, rosemary and Pineapple Sage. Yay! The great thing about a fall garden is that there are no bugs. My kale looks great, unlike my summer kale which was devoured by grasshoppers. Next year...netting...
